Spanish Water Dog are inexhaustible workers. Their naturally curly and wooly coat, when grown out, will often form tight, tapered cords. In full coat, the facial hair covers the expressive brown eyes. Colors can be black, brown, beige, white, or particolor (black, brown, beige, with white). “Rustic” is the word often used to describe the overall look of this sturdy dog of medium size.
